Technical specifications
Communications
RS232 via a standard modem cable terminated with male and female 9-pin Sub-D connector at each
end. Cable length <3 metre. A USB- RS232 adaptor may be used.
4-20 mA output for flux
4-20 mA output for pipe temperature

Memory
The memory will record approximately 18 months of data. Once memory is full data is logged in a first in first
out rolling cycle by memory sector.
Diagnostics
Operating temp -40 C to 60 C
H2 sensor Electrolytic conductivity
Flow 30 ml/min +/-3%
Power alarm Insufficient supply voltage
Visual Alarm Via red LED on instrument
Transmitted alarm 3.5 mA on 4-20 mA outputs
Log to memory
Operating lifetime
Pump 10,000 hr cumulative use
